TL;DR

  • The Minneapolis ARTCC lost radar and communications for ~2 hours on August 6, disrupting 1,100+ flights across a nine-state sector, highlighting ongoing critical infrastructure failures in the US air traffic control system.
  • Elon Musk's DOGE failed to deliver promised "rapid safety upgrades" to the FAA, instead terminating 400 maintenance technicians and mismanaging the overhaul effort, while equipment failures and staffing shortages have persisted across multiple centers.
  • Palantir has rapidly expanded its footprint within the FAA through a series of no-bid contracts for AI-powered systems (runway collision avoidance, grants management, Foundry OS integration), despite limited air traffic control experience, capturing most of the $12.5 billion in authorized FAA funding.
  • The $12.5 billion supplemental funding contains zero allocation for personnel, while the FAA has simultaneously lowered its controller staffing target from 14,633 to 12,563, citing unproven AI and scheduling improvements as justification.
  • 2025 was the worst year for flight delays in over a decade (1.7 million disruptions, 25% of flights affected), and the controller suicide rate is eight times the national average, underscoring a systemic crisis driven by chronic understaffing, burnout, and aging infrastructure.

Technical Details

  • The FAA's air traffic control infrastructure is classified as largely "unsustainable" or "potentially unsustainable," with chronic equipment failures reported in Dallas, Denver, Houston (radar outages), Atlanta/Newark/Potomac (unexplained fumes), and pervasive staffing shortages across Boston, New York, LA, Orlando, and Philadelphia.
  • Palantir's Foundry platform serves as the FAA's central data integration and analytics backbone, with its proprietary Ontology schema and Foundry Operating System now winning no-bid contracts for AI integration across the agency — creating significant vendor lock-in risk.
  • The FAA's $875 million SMART (NextGen) national airspace system contract — an AI-powered traffic flow management and disruption prediction tool — was ultimately awarded to Air Space Intelligence, a startup whose executive team includes four Palantir alumni, illustrating the revolving-door dynamic between Palantir and FAA-adjacent vendors.
  • The "Level Up Your Career" recruitment initiative generated 2,000 applications but faces a 30% washout rate during training and up to three years to full certification, while the FAA's revised staffing target dropped by ~2,070 controllers, justified by claimed AI and scheduling efficiencies.
  • The One Big Beautiful Bill Act (July 2025) authorized $12.5 billion for FAA overhaul, with ~$5 billion earmarked for software upgrades, yet zero dollars allocated to personnel — a structural funding gap that prioritizes technology contracts over workforce sustainability.

Industry Insight

  • Vendor lock-in through proprietary data schemas (e.g., Palantir's Ontology/Foundry) creates long-term dependency and limits competitive bidding, suggesting that government AI procurement frameworks need stronger interoperability requirements and anti-monopoly safeguards.
  • The gap between political narratives (blaming controller sick calls for delays) and operational reality (decades of understaffing, unsustainable equipment, punishing schedules) highlights the risk of deploying AI and automation solutions without first addressing foundational workforce and infrastructure needs — a lesson applicable across all critical AI deployment domains.
  • The revolving door between major government AI contractors and emerging startups (Palantir alumni leading Air Space Intelligence) suggests that contractor ecosystems can self-perpetuate, concentrating influence and expertise within a narrow network that may not prioritize end-user or public outcomes.
